Warning Signs You Need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ration
Catching these warning sign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some common signs that show you need professional help: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ant musty odors can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ice a persistent smell that won’t go away, it’s worth investigating further.
Water Stains on Your Laminate Floor
Water stains on your laminate floor can be a sign of a more serious issue. If you notice water stains, it’s essential to address the problem quickly to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Laminate Flooring
Warped or buckled laminate flooring can be a sign of water damage or excessive moisture. If you notice your laminate flooring is warped or buckled, it’s worth addressing the issue to prevent further damage.
Increased Humidity Levels
Increased humidity levels can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ice your home is more humid than usual, it’s worth investigating further to prevent bigger problems.
Discoloration or Warping of Baseboards
Discoloration or warping of baseboards can be a sign of water damage or excessive moisture. If you notice your baseboards are discolored or warped, it’s worth addressing the issue to prevent further damage.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or excessive moisture. If you notice your paint or wallpaper is peeling, it’s worth investigating further to prevent bigger problems.

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Ellicott City, MD
The cost of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in your neighborhood.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$200-$1,000 | The size of the affected area, complexity of the issue, and equipment needed. |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$800-$3,000 | The amount of water extracted, equipment needed, and drying protocols employed. |
| Cleaning and Disinfection | $300-$1,500 | The extent of cleaning and disinfection required, equipment needed, and labor costs. |
| Restoration and Rebuilding | $1,000-$5,000 | The extent of restoration and rebuilding required, equipment needed, and labor costs. |

Common Questions About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ration
How Long Does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ration Take?
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ration can take anywhere from a few days to a week or more, depending on the severity of the issue and the extent of the damage. Our team will work with you to develop a customized plan that meets your needs and schedule.
Is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ration Covered by Insurance?
Yes,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ration may be covered by your homeowners insurance policy. But, it’s essential to review your policy and contact your insurance provider to confirm coverage and any requirements.
How Much Does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ost?
The cost of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in your neighborhood. Our team will provide a personalized quote based on an on-site assessment.
Can I Prevent Laminate Floor Water Damage?
Yes, you can take steps to prevent Laminate Floor Water Damage by ensuring proper drainage, inspecting your home regularly for signs of water damage, and addressing any issues quickly.
What Happens If I Ignore Laminate Floor Water Damage?
If you ignore Laminate Floor Water Damage, it can lead to more severe consequences, including mold growth, structural damage, and increased risk of further water damage.
